    I had just cleaned her after a trip out to the range . Had not oiled her yet . Fifty rounds of OO used to hurt my shoulder , things havn't changed much over the years .
    Some notes . This gun has the early non-"S" stamped adaptor , correct as per my conversation with Bruce Canfield on how early early was and how late late was . The adaptor has a hole so that these could be used on Winchesters as replacement stock . See how the shells set for feeding . The stamping placement on trench barrels and the ones in front of the triggerguard .
